Dock Enlargement in Overland Park, KS
Dock enlargement services involve expanding or modifying existing dock structures to increase their size, functionality, or capacity. These projects typically include lengthening the dock, adding additional platforms, or widening the overall structure to accommodate more boats, equipment, or recreational activities. Property owners often seek this service to better suit their boating needs, improve access, or enhance the usability of their waterfront area, whether for personal enjoyment or increased property value.
Before requesting dock enlargement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the materials used, the impact on existing structures, and any local regulations or permits required. It’s also common to consider the durability of the materials, the compatibility with current dock features, and the overall design to ensure the enlarged dock meets future needs.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help facilitate a smooth and successful upgrade.
